My sister accidentally let what I believe to be a virus into my computer by clicking on false advertisements.
I'm not sure what kind of virus it is or how to get rid of it, but here are the symptoms:
*It renamed my computer to '693'
*I cannot use my system restore
*I am getting tons of porn pop-ups and links that are terribly hard to get rid of
*And it drastically slowed my computer down

If you have an Antivirus Program update your virus definitions and run a full virus scan. If you don't go to the link below and run the Free "Housecall" online virus scan.

Housecall

Download, install, read the directions, then update and run Spybot Search & Destroy at the link below. Make sure you update it from within the program prior to running it.
